Newton Abbey, UK: David & Charles, 1971. First Edition. Cloth. Near Fine/Near Fine. G. V. Berry (photographs). 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all. 219pp. Vivid close-ups of twelve aspects of life in the Lakeland district. Topics include the Drovers and their fares and routes, the bobbin-makers, the railroads, and a detailed history of the Westmoreland village of Troutbeck. Illustrated with maps, facsimiles of posterss, photographs, and reproductions of early engravings. References. Index. In light brown cloth, and illustrated (maps) dust jacket. (Inventory #: 003659)
